Langworthy, Greater Manchester : ウィキペディア英語版
Langworthy, Salford

Langworthy is an area and council ward〔http://www.salford.gov.uk/d/Langworthy(1).pdf〕 of Salford, Greater Manchester. Weaste lies to the west of Langworthy and Pendleton to the east. In 2001 the population of Langworthy was 7,104.〔http://www.neighbourhood.statistics.gov.uk/dissemination/LeadKeyFigures.do?a=7&b=6263789&c=langworthy&d=14&e=15&g=353630&i=1001x1003x1004&m=0&r=1&s=1346753174521&enc=1〕 It was named after Edward Ryley Langworthy, a former mayor of Salford.
==Governance==
Pendleton was part of the County Borough of Salford, and in 1974 became part of the metropolitan borough of the City of Salford, and metropolitan county of Greater Manchester.
